全國最多中醫師線上諮詢網站-台灣中醫網
發文 回覆 瀏覽次數:1384
推到 Plurk!
推到 Facebook!

listbox可以被SetFocus

答題得分者是:pedro
120914783
一般會員


發表:8
回覆:1
積分:1
註冊:2004-01-07

發送簡訊給我
#1 引用回覆 回覆 發表時間:2004-02-05 16:56:53 IP:211.76.xxx.xxx 未訂閱
您好! 請問listbox可以被設定SetFocus? 我的寫法如下: procedure Tsorderf.Edip1KeyDown(Sender: TObject; var Key: Word; Shift: TShiftState); begin if key =$0D then if listbox.CanFocus then listbox.SetFocus; end; 以上程式無法設定 listbox 成 SetFocus 請問要如何修改?謝謝! 林文章 林文章
------
林文章
pedro
尊榮會員


發表:152
回覆:1187
積分:892
註冊:2002-06-12

發送簡訊給我
#2 引用回覆 回覆 發表時間:2004-02-05 17:12:16 IP:210.61.xxx.xxx 未訂閱
您好 下面片段可以達到您要的需求
  if Key=$0D then
  begin
    if not ListBox1.Focused then
      ListBox1.SetFocus;
  end;
ps: 您po錯區了唷! 可以po在vcl區或misc區....
120914783
一般會員


發表:8
回覆:1
積分:1
註冊:2004-01-07

發送簡訊給我
#3 引用回覆 回覆 發表時間:2004-02-05 17:45:43 IP:211.76.xxx.xxx 未訂閱
謝謝曾先生幫忙我解決了問題! 林文章
------
林文章
系統時間:2024-05-08 8:48:19
聯絡我們 | Delphi K.Top討論版
本站聲明
1. 本論壇為無營利行為之開放平台,所有文章都是由網友自行張貼,如牽涉到法律糾紛一切與本站無關。
2. 假如網友發表之內容涉及侵權,而損及您的利益,請立即通知版主刪除。
3. 請勿批評中華民國元首及政府或批評各政黨,是藍是綠本站無權干涉,但這裡不是政治性論壇!